General chart embracing surveys of the Farallones entrance to the Bay of San Francisco, Bays of San Francisco and San Pablo, Straits of Carquines and Suisun Bay, and the Sacramento and San Joaquin Rivers to the cities of Sacramento and San Joaquin, California

description

Summary


Relief shown by hachures and spot heights. Depths shown by soundings.
Shows drainage, distancees, etc.
"Constructed, projected and drawn by Fred D. Stuart, hydrographer, late of the U.S. Ex. Ex. ; assisted by Chas. Everett, Jr., draughtsman."
"Executed at the request of the undersigned citizens of the State of California ... and inscribed to William H. Aspinwall, Esq., City of New York."
LC copy: Signed in ink script on verso: Millard Fillmore. San Francisco Bay Area 1850. No. 135.
LC copy: Mounted on cloth backing, sheet sectioned into 18 panels to enable folding.
Includes table of distances by rivers.
